Class Generated::OpaqueTypeDecl
A declaration of an opaque type, that is formally equivalent to a given type but abstracts it away.
Such a declaration is implicitly given when a declaration is written with an opaque result type, for example
func opaque() -> some SignedInteger { return 1 }
